Company Description
Embed Software Limited is an independent company specializing in high-integrity, safety-critical software development and engineering services. We provide innovative solutions across a variety of industries, guiding our clients from concept and design through to product release and beyond. Our focus on excellence and reliability ensures the delivery of cutting-edge software that meets rigorous standards.
Role Description
This is a full-time Senior Software Engineer position located in Kirkcaldy, with the flexibility for some remote work. The role involves designing, developing, and maintaining high-integrity safety critical software systems. The successful candidate will collaborate with cross-functional teams, participate in code reviews, and provide technical mentorship to junior team members while ensuring compliance with safety-critical standards.
Qualifications
Proficiency in Computer Science fundamentals and principles
Strong expertise in Embedded Development
Advanced skills in Programming and Object-Oriented Programming (C, C++, C# and Python)
Proven experience in designing and delivering reliable, high-integrity safety critical software engineering solutions
Ability to work collaboratively within a multidisciplinary team
Bachelor's degree in Computer Science, Software Engineering, or a related field
Strong analytical, problem-solving, written and verbal communication skills
Experience working to regulatory standards including ISO 13485, IEC 62304, IEC 61508, and FDA requirements
Knowledge of software testing and verification techniques